From: Prediction and prevention of hypertensive disorders of pregnancy

Figure 1

Scatter plot showing the relationship between the false-positive rate (FPR) and the sensitivity to predict early-onset preeclampsia (PE) by uterine artery Doppler (UAD) alone in the first trimester (a) and UAD alone in the second trimester (b). Closed circles indicate unselected or low-risk women, and closed triangles indicate high-risk women. When the FPR was <10%, the regression line of the sensitivity of FPR, including 0% FPR and 0% sensitivity, was plotted in unselected or low-risk women, and, when the FPR was 10%, the regression line of the sensitivity on FPR, including 100% FPR and 100% sensitivity, was plotted in unselected or low-risk women.
